Aprio is a premier CPA and business advisory firm that advises clients and associates on how to achieve what’s next. Aprio’s associates work as integrated teams across advisory, assurance, tax, outsourcing, staffing and private client services, bringing the best thinking and personal commitment to each client. Across practices, Aprio brings together proven expertise, deep understanding and strategic foresight for industries including Manufacturing and Distribution; Non-Profit and Education; Professional Services; Real Estate and Construction; Retail, Franchise and Hospitality; and Technology and Blockchain. Head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, Aprio has grown to over 1,000+ team members. To serve clients wherever life or business may take them, Aprio’s teams speak more than 30 languages and work with clients in over 50 countries.

Responsibilities:
  • Aprio’s tax professionals are committed to exceptional client service and developing and implementing intelligent strategies that can reduce our clients' tax bills.
  • Responsible for managing and leading a team of tax professionals, delegating tasks and responsibilities, and overseeing the work of your team members.
  • Developing and implementing tax strategies. This will involve staying up-to-date with changing tax laws and regulations and identifying opportunities for tax planning.
  • Providing consulting services to clients on various tax-related issues such as mergers and acquisitions, tax planning, and corporate restructuring.
  • Conduct tax research to stay up-to-date with changing tax laws and regulations and identify opportunities for tax planning.
  • Responsible for preparing and reviewing tax returns for clients, ensuring that they comply with relevant tax laws and regulations.
  • Responsible for communicating with clients and stakeholders, including tax authorities and other regulatory bodies, to ensure that all tax-related matters are handled effectively and efficiently.
  • Manage client relationships and ensure that clients are satisfied with the services provided by your team.
  • Training and mentoring team members.

  •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ting.
  • Master’s degree in Taxation preferred.
  • Recent experience working in a public accounting firm.
  • International tax experience is preferred. 
  • 6+ experience years of federal tax consulting and/or compliance experience in accounting
  • CPA is preferred.
  • Experience in S-Corp, Partnership returns, Individual and Corporate.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ills.
  • Previous experience with state and local tax compliance and planning. 
  • Computer expertise including knowledge of tax software and technology.
  • Experience managing a team.
